Transaction e673697dd2733ea0b32d2fedf578d942b62cee7a4db3809cd5791e2495009d3b
1 Input
1 Output
-
e673697dd2733ea0b32d2fedf578d942b62cee7a4db3809cd5791e2495009d3b:0
- value
- 44898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ac9911894985d14593ebb69d5b9589aea29f97b8 OP_EQUAL
- address
- 3HRdWvaFCcVmMxR8w6o9eX3ezSmLfMo6Pa